Development is potentially affected both by temperature and daylength. Growth is modeled via a radiation use efficiency approach. Bread and durum wheat may be simulated using the CERES-Wheat model, whose origins trace back to modeling efforts of Joe Ritchie and colleagues in the 1970s (Ritchie et al., 1984).
